Psalms 6

1For the Leader; with string-music; on the Sheminith. A Psalm of David. 2O HaShem, rebuke me not in Thine anger, neither chasten me in Thy wrath. 3Be gracious unto me, O HaShem, for I languish away; heal me, O HaShem, for my bones are affrighted. 4My soul also is sore affrighted; and Thou, O HaShem, how long? 5Return, O HaShem, deliver my soul; save me for Thy mercy's sake. 6For in death there is no remembrance of Thee; in the nether-world who will give Thee thanks? 7I am weary with my groaning; every night make I my bed to swim; I melt away my couch with my tears. 8Mine eye is dimmed because of vexation; it waxeth old because of all mine adversaries. 9Depart from me, all ye workers of iniquity; for HaShem hath heard the voice of my weeping. 10HaShem hath heard my supplication; HaShem receiveth my prayer. 11All mine enemies shall be ashamed and sore affrighted; they shall turn back, they shall be ashamed suddenly.
